Bangkok (VNA) – Vietnamese Ambassadorto Thailand Phan Chi Thanh held a working session with Thai Minister of SocialDevelopment and Human Security Chuti Krairiksh in Bangkok on July 12 to promotebilateral cooperation in combating human trafficking and share experience insocial welfare development.
Hailing Vietnam as one of the important member states that hasmade active contributions to cooperation mechanisms at ASEAN, Chuti wished thatVietnam and Thailand would enhance bilateral coordination as well as at othermultilateral mechanisms.
He proposed that the Vietnamese Embassy work closely withthe Thai Ministry of Social Development and Human Security to launch certainactivities of the "Ambassador of Goodwill" project regarding socialissues.
The minister suggested the establishment of a support groupinvolving relevant units from the Thai Ministry of Social Development and HumanSecurity and the Vietnamese Embassy to address fraud, human trafficking, andillegal immigration issues in preparation for the forthcoming deputy ministerial-levelmeeting on cooperation in combating human trafficking scheduled to take placein Vietnam in this September.
Ambassador Thanh, for his part, thanked the Government, ministriesand police of Thailand for their assistance to Vietnamese victims who weredeceived into working at online scam centres in Thailand with the intention ofbeing transported to a third country.
He also agreed with Chuti’s proposal regarding the"Ambassador of Goodwill" project to foster exchanges between younggenerations of both countries.
TheVietnamese Embassy is ready to work with the Thai ministry’s departments andagencies to addresscases of fraud and human trafficking to Thailand, he said./.
